Firefighter Hose Craft

This is a great craft for firefighter themed programs for toddlers or preschoolers. There is a minimal amount of materials, and assembly is simple. Decoration can be done with many forms of media such as paint, crayons, or glue-on decorations. The children in our classes had fun using them for the "fire calls" which occurred during class.



Materials

  • cardboard tube - you can use a standard paper towel roll tube though its strength/durability will be limited. We are fortunate to have access to tubes which are a little stronger. It is advisable to keep the tubes short (under 12") to keep any sword fighting tendencies to a minimum.
  • blue tissue paper: this is used as the water. A piece about 10" long can be rolled up and just stuffed into the end of the tube. If it is thick enough it can be jammed into the tube tightly and it should stay.

Instructions

  • After decorating and dry the tissue "water" is just stuffed into the end of the tube. Now all your little firefighters are ready for action.
